.dice-result-indicator{position:absolute;top:0;transform:translate(-50%,calc(-100% - 8px));z-index:20;transition-property:left,opacity;transition-duration:1.5s,.5s;transition-timing-function:ease-out}.dice-result-indicator.fading-out{opacity:0}.dice-result-badge{position:relative;width:72px;height:72px;display:flex;align-items:center;justify-content:center;background:linear-gradient(135deg,#ffffff,#f5f5f5);border-radius:16px;box-shadow:0 8px 24px rgba(0,0,0,.4),0 4px 8px rgba(0,0,0,.2),inset 0 1px 0 rgba(255,255,255,.8);border:2px solid rgba(255,255,255,.3)}.dice-result-badge:before{content:"";position:absolute;inset:3px;background:linear-gradient(135deg,rgba(255,255,255,.8),rgba(255,255,255,.2));border-radius:12px;pointer-events:none}.dice-result-number{position:relative;z-index:10;font-size:1.25rem;font-weight:800;text-shadow:0 1px 2px rgba(0,0,0,.1)}.dice-result-number.win{color:rgb(34 197 94)}.dice-result-number.loss{color:rgb(239 68 68)}.dice-result-connector{position:absolute;top:100%;left:50%;transform:translateX(-50%);width:3px;height:10px;background:linear-gradient(180deg,rgba(255,255,255,.6),rgba(255,255,255,.2));border-radius:2px}.dice-slider-container{position:relative;width:100%;max-width:700px;margin:0 auto}.dice-slider-scale{position:relative;width:100%;height:40px;display:flex;align-items:center;margin-bottom:12px}.dice-slider-scale-label{position:absolute;font-size:1.125rem;font-weight:600;transform:translateX(-50%);user-select:none}.dice-slider-scale-label:first-child{left:3%;transform:translateX(0)}.dice-slider-scale-label:nth-child(2){left:26.5%}.dice-slider-scale-label:nth-child(3){left:50%}.dice-slider-scale-label:nth-child(4){left:73.5%}.dice-slider-scale-label:last-child{left:97%;transform:translateX(-100%)}.dice-slider-wrapper{position:relative;width:100%;padding:20px;background:rgba(0,0,0,.2);border:2px solid rgba(255,255,255,.1);border-radius:50px;box-shadow:0 4px 20px rgba(0,0,0,.3)}.dice-slider-track{position:relative;width:100%;height:25px;border-radius:24px;cursor:pointer;overflow:visible;transition:box-shadow .2s ease;user-select: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;touch-action:none}.dice-slider-track:hover{box-shadow:0 0 20px rgba(255,255,255,.1)}.dice-slider-color-track{transition:background .1s ease-out}.dice-slider-color-track,.dice-slider-color-track:before{position:absolute;top:0;left:0;width:100%;height:100%;border-radius:24px}.dice-slider-color-track:before{content:"";background:repeating-linear-gradient(-45deg,transparent,transparent 10px,rgba(0,0,0,.05) 0,rgba(0,0,0,.05) 20px);pointer-events:none}.dice-slider-handle{position:absolute;top:50%;transform:translate(-50%,-50%);width:35px;height:45px;background:linear-gradient(180deg,#f0f0f0,#d0d0d0);border-radius:8px;cursor:grab;box-shadow:0 4px 12px rgba(0,0,0,.4),inset 0 1px 0 rgba(255,255,255,.5);transition:box-shadow .2s ease,transform .1s ease;z-index:10;user-select: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;touch-action:none}.dice-slider-handle:hover{box-shadow:0 6px 16px rgba(0,0,0,.5),inset 0 1px 0 rgba(255,255,255,.6)}.dice-slider-handle.dragging,.dice-slider-handle:active{cursor:grabbing;transform:translate(-50%,-50%) scale(1.05);box-shadow:0 8px 20px rgba(0,0,0,.6),inset 0 1px 0 rgba(255,255,255,.7)}.dice-slider-handle-grip{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);display:flex;gap:4px;align-items:center;justify-content:center}.dice-slider-grip-line{width:2px;height:32px;background:rgba(0,0,0,.15);border-radius:1px}@media (max-width:915px){.dice-slider-scale{height:28px;margin-bottom:8px}.dice-slider-scale-label{font-size:.95rem}.dice-slider-wrapper{padding:14px;border-radius:40px}.dice-slider-track{height:20px;border-radius:20px}.dice-slider-handle{width:28px;height:50px}.dice-slider-handle-grip{gap:3px}.dice-slider-grip-line{height:24px}}